Quick Sourcing Note

XL-3215RGBC from XINGLIGHT is a high brightness RGB LED in a 3.2 x 1.0 x 1.1 mm SMD LED package with transparent colloid. The device provides red, green, and blue emission with dominant wavelength ranges of 620-625 nm, 515-530 nm, and 460-475 nm at IF=20 mA and Ta=25°C. Typical peak wavelengths are 625 nm red, 525 nm green, and 465 nm blue. It supports a 120 deg typical viewing angle, 25 mA forward working current per color, MSL 3 handling, and -40°C to +85°C operating and storage temperature ranges for compact RGB indication and backlighting uses.

Product Overview

Electrical ratings at Ta=25°C include 25 mA forward working current for each color, 80 mA peak forward current under pulse width <=0.1 ms and duty <=1/10, and 5 V reverse voltage for red, green, and blue. Power dissipation ratings are 50 mW for red and 70 mW for green and blue. ESD withstand voltage is specified at 2000 V.

Optical parameters at IF=20 mA and Ta=25°C include luminous intensity ranges of 80-210 mcd for red, 500-900 mcd for green, and 80-210 mcd for blue. Dominant wavelength ranges are 620-625 nm red, 515-530 nm green, and 460-475 nm blue, with a 120 deg typical viewing angle.

Assembly and storage controls include MSL 3 classification, reflow soldering at 260°C for 6 s, manual soldering at 300°C for 3 s, unopened storage at <=30°C and <60% RH within 1 year, and opened-package soldering within 168 hours / 7 days at <=30°C and <40% RH.

Procurement Notes

When requesting a quote for XL-3215RGBC, buyers should confirm the manufacturer, package or case, required quantity, target date code, compliance documents, packing method, destination country and expected delivery schedule.

If alternatives are acceptable, buyers should share the approved vendor list, required electrical or optical limits, package constraints and qualification requirements. Any alternative part should be reviewed by the buyer's engineering team before production use.

For LED and optoelectronic sourcing, brightness bin, wavelength or color temperature bin, forward voltage range, viewing angle, moisture sensitivity level and soldering process limits may affect final selection, availability and lead time.
